Cleaning Steps for the Cream Machine
-
Disassemble: Please use extreme caution when lifting the cream machine to remove all hoppers, nozzles, and cream interfacing parts.
-
Initial Rinse: Soaking components in warm water is the best approach for removing leftover peripheral debris.
-
Cleaning with Detergent: Using the correct food-grade tools to scrub and brush surfaces helps eliminate the remaining cream residue.
-
Sanitization: Food-grade sanitizers eliminate all surfaces treated for the maximum duration; therefore, applying them for the maximum duration on all surfaces guarantees stubborn bacteria removal.
-
Final Rinse and Drying: Performing these steps greatly helps with removing all cleansing agents, residual debris, and creams. Furthermore, air drying the parts guarantees no moisture is retained.
